A company can send a maximum of 40 workers to complete a
task. The manager needs to limit the total cost of the workers
within $1000. He needs to pay $30 and $20 to each female
and male worker for this task respectively. Write a system of
inequalities to express this situation. What is the least possible
number of male workers the manager should send to meet the
requirements?
male workers

Answers

Answer:

20

Step-by-step explanation:

For the sake of the problem, let's make female workers "x" and male workers "y".

x+y<40       This equation shows that the total number of workers has a max of 40.

30x+20y<1,000      This equation shows that the total cost the manager pays ($30 to each woman, $20 to each man) has a max of $1,000.  

Now you can solve for x and y.

X+y<40

-y       -y

X<-y+40

Substitute -y+40 in for X in the second equation

30(-y+40)+20y<1,000      

-30y+1200+20y<1,000         Distribute

-10y+1,200<1,000      Combine like terms

-10y<-200                   Subtract 1,200

y>20                Divide by -10; flip the sign

Since y>20, and y=male workers, you now know that the minimum

number of male workers he should send is 20

2x + 5y = 6
2x = 10 – 3y

Solve the simultaneous equations by substitution

(Sorry all my questions are maths i suck, more to come)

Answers

Step-by-step explanation:

Given equations

2x + 5y = 6 .......i)

2x = 10 - 3y...... II)

Putting 2x = 10 - 3y in equation i

10 - 3y + 5y = 6

2y = 6 - 10

2y = - 4

y = - 4 / 2

y = - 2

Now putting y = - 2 in equation ii

2x = 10 - 3 * ( - 2)

2x = 10 + 6

2x = 16

x = 16 / 2

x = 8

So x = 8 and y = - 2

12:8:100 in its simplest form as a ratio is 3:2:25 .

What is simplest form of the ratio?

The simplest form of the ratio is when the numbers are expressed as natural numbers with no common factors between them. For example, 2: 4 can be written in the simplest form as 1: 2.

According to the question

12:8:100 in its simplest form as a ratio.

 As ,

simplest form of the ratio is when the numbers are expressed as natural numbers with no common factors  

i.e

dividing by common factors of all 3 which is 4

3:2:25

Hence,  12:8:100 in its simplest form as a ratio is 3:2:25 ,
